About Organization
The National Institute on the Teaching sponsors annual national conferences designed to enhance the teaching capabilities of high school and college psychology instructors through expert-led training. Based in Northport, AL, the organization delivers programming through comprehensive conference formats featuring workshops, professional lectures, and discussion groups where educators share classroom strategies. With $188,000 in annual revenue, they serve psychology teachers nationwide.
